Description :
In collaboration with the Head of Testing, the Senior Automation Test Lead will be responsible for defining and implementing an automation strategy supporting cross functional project teams, designed to support regression testing and release cycles. Working within the IT Test Team, alongside business analysts, developers and project managers, undertaking testing of software developed for internal and external clients, ensuring the software performs the functions as required to produce the required end result.

To deliver high quality testing, test documentation and test result interpretation in a timely manner and contribute towards the upholding of existing and establishment of new system documentation, procedures and standards including test plans.

Key Responsibilities:

*Define and implement an automation test strategy in line with business goals, reporting to the Head of Testing with progress and updates of strategy and implementation deliverables.
*Develop and maintain a test automation suite, reusable components and functional libraries
*Design, develop, execute and maintain automated and manual test scripts.
*Undertake the testing of new applications and enhancements to existing applications based on the latest department standards and testing best practices.
*Implement a method of carrying out black box testing - i.e. software testing from the point of view of a user.
*Identify, communicate & document discrepancies encountered during testing.
*Develop, enhance, support and perform testing using new or existing automation framework for testing suites (such as Selenium WebDriver or similar products).
*Support automated script development and execution within scrum teams.
*Collaborate with product owners, stakeholders and scrum team.
*Where appropriate write realistic test plans to focus on critical and essential functionality, to ensure testing time available is used as efficiently as possible.
*To adopt an organised and methodological approach to testing and fully document the process and outcome.
*Setting up required test data and monitor the performance of software tested.
*Develop and maintain automated testing environments for development and execution
*Design, develop and maintain dynamic test data creation
*Create and maintain technical documentation relating to standard test plans for specific business areas.
*To be aware of and understand the objectives of the department and understand how the work of this role contributes to the achievement of these objectives.


Skill Requirements:

*Strong understanding of QA methodology and the software development life­cycle.
*Minimum of 5 years of software quality assurance experience with a focus on web based applications and APIs.
*Minimum of 3 years Automation testing experience using Selenium WebDriver
*Ability to code using JAVA with knowledge of Cucumber, Jenkins and Soap UI
*Experience of implementing and developing an automation framework
*Experience of building and executing automated tests with Selenium.
*Experience developing tests for functional and regression testing that includes automated, ad­hoc, and manual.
*Good understanding of OOP concepts, web services automation and test automation.
*Familiar with all types of testing within an agile environment.
*Experience testing software and web applications in an agile (scrum) environment.
*Experience of web standards and experience of testing REST and SOAP APIs
*Familiarity of various test and defect management tools (Bugzilla, JIRA).
*Understanding of the requirements involved in software testing with strong analytical and empirical skills.
*Experience in the testing of web based applications across multiple browsers.
*Excellent understanding of software development lifecycle (SDLC).
*High attention to detail with excellent analytical and troubleshooting skills.
*Excellent verbal and written communications skills.
*Awareness of structure, functions and business environment of the organisation.
*Meticulous approach to working and attention to detail, practical and systematic approach to testing.
*Strong organisational skills and effective time management.
*Excellent interpersonal and communication skills and ability to work within a team.
*Committed to providing excellent standards of customer service.
*Ability to work independently and contribute well within a team.
*Ability to quickly adapt within a fast changing environment.

Desirable Requirements:

*ISTQB Certified
*Educated to Degree level
*Programming background
*Experience with Java
*Experience with J-Unit framework
*Strong SQL skills
